Dryer lint can be used as kindling for starting your campfire. Start collecting it in advance of your trip. Simply hang a plastic bag near the dryer and stash the lint in the bag as it collects. The morning of your departure, all you need to do is grab the bag and depart, kindling sorted!

If your campsite is known for wildlife, be extremely careful with food. You will need to keep your food in airtight containers or securely wrapped, and store it away from your tent. Some foods should be avoided entirely. Doing this means you cut down on your possibilities of an animal attack.

Choose an appropriate sleeping bag that is made for the time of year you will be camping. For instance, in the summertime, a lighter bag will keep you cool. When it’s cold, it’s a good idea to get a thicker bag so you’re not too cold.
Plan ahead and come prepared. While a sleeping bag is obvious, it is still a good idea to bring extra blankets. This will keep you warm if it gets really cool at night and/or you can use them for additional padding.

Trail mix and jerky are great snacks for a camping trip. These little nutritious snacks can come in handy after a long day. They stay fresh for a while, so you do not have to worry about them going bad if you do not use them up right away.
